Nigeria: Your Alarm On Nation's Debt Profile False - Govt Replies Atiku

The Federal Government says the "alarm and doom" predictions by former Vice President Atiku Abubakar on the country's debt profile is anchored on a false premise.

In the statement, the minister stressed that the scenarios on the country's debt profile as painted by Mr Atiku in a release he issued on Tuesday had no basis.

The minister said the figure of Nigeria's debt to revenue ratio of 99 per cent in the first quarter of 2020, quoted by Mr Atiku was not in the Medium-Term Expenditure Framework and Fiscal Strategy Paper, where he claimed he got it from.

The minister said Nigeria had not experienced alarming and unprecedented increase in the ratios of debt to GDP and debt service to revenue as posited by Mr Atiku.

Mr Mohammed added that the government is making concerted efforts to increase revenue so as to bring down the ratio of debt service to revenue.
